GroupDocs.Annotation 開発者ガイド - Document Annotation API
このガイドでは、document annotation API がどのように、ハイライト、コメント、図形などのリッチな注釈機能を PDF、Word、Excel、PowerPoint、その他多数のファイル形式に直接埋め込むことを可能にするかをご紹介します。共同レビュー ポータル、教育アプリ、法務文書ワークフローのいずれを構築する場合でも、.NET と Java の環境で一貫した高性能な注釈操作が提供されます。
クイック回答
- document annotation API は何をしますか? 開発者は外部依存なしで、50 以上のドキュメント形式に対して注釈の追加、編集、管理を行うことができます。
- どのプラットフォームがサポートされていますか? .NET (Framework, Core, .NET 5/6) と Java (JDK 8 以上) がサポートされています。
- 開発にライセンスは必要ですか? 無料トライアルが利用可能で、製品環境での使用にはライセンスが必要です。
- PDF と Office ファイルを同じコードで注釈付けできますか? はい。統一された API が PDF、Word、Excel、PowerPoint、画像、HTML などを処理します。
- クラウドへのデプロイは可能ですか? もちろんです。Windows、Linux、macOS、Docker、または任意のクラウドサービス上で実行できます。
Document Annotation API とは?
document annotation API は、ドキュメントのレンダリングと変更の複雑さを抽象化したクロスプラットフォーム SDK です。テキストのハイライト、下線、取り消し線、コメント、付箋、図形、透かし、さらにはインタラクティブなフォームフィールドをプログラムから作成できるシンプルなオブジェクトモデルを提供します。
GroupDocs.Annotation を選ぶ理由
- Format Independence – 1 つの API で PDF から Excel スプレッドシートまで、50 以上のドキュメントタイプに対応します。
- Rich Annotation Types – テキストマークアップ、グラフィカルシェイプ、コメント、共同返信スレッドがすべて組み込まれています。
- No External Dependencies – Adobe Reader、Office、その他サードパーティツールは不要です。
- High‑Performance Rendering – 高速プレビュー生成のために品質と解像度を調整可能です。
- Cross‑Platform Support – Windows、Linux、macOS、Docker、サーバーレス環境でもシームレスに実行できます。
主なユースケース
- Document Review Workflows – レビュー担当者がリアルタイムでコメントを追加し、変更を承認できるようにします。
- Educational Applications – 教師が教材をハイライトし、文書内で直接フィードバックを提供できます。
- Legal Document Processing – 条項にマークを付け、ノートを追加し、契約書の改訂履歴を追跡できます。
- Healthcare Documentation – 重要な患者情報をハイライトし、HIPAA 準拠を維持できます。
- Construction & Engineering – 青図、回路図、技術図面に正確な測定値で注釈を付けられます。
.NET での開始
強力な Document Annotation を .NET アプリケーション向けに提供
機能豊富な API を使用して、C# および .NET プロジェクトに包括的な注釈機能を統合できます。
必要な .NET チュートリアル
- Document Loading - ファイル、ストリーム、URL、クラウドストレージからドキュメントをロードします
- Annotation Types - テキスト、グラフィカル、フォーム、画像の注釈を実装します
- Document Saving - さまざまな出力オプションで注釈付きドキュメントを保存します
- Annotation Management - プログラムから注釈の追加、更新、削除、フィルタリングを行います
- Collaboration Features - コメントスレッドと共同レビューを実装します
高度な .NET 機能
- Document Preview - カスタム解像度でドキュメントプレビューを生成します
- Form Fields - インタラクティブなフォームコンポーネントを作成します
- Document Analysis - メタデータとページ情報を抽出します
- Licensing Options - ライセンスの実装と設定を行います
Java での開始
Java Document Annotation SDK
プラットフォームに依存しない API を使用して、Java アプリケーションに包括的な注釈機能を追加します。
必要な Java チュートリアル
- Document Loading - クラウドストレージ統合を含む複数の方法でドキュメントをロードします
- Text Annotations - ハイライト、下線、取り消し線、テキスト置換
- Graphical Annotations - 矢印、図形、測定値を追加します
- Image Annotations - ドキュメントに画像を挿入しカスタマイズします
- Annotation Management - 注釈のライフサイクル全体を管理します
高度な Java 機能
- Document Preview - 高品質なサムネイルとプレビューを生成します
- Collaboration Tools - スレッド化されたコメントと返信を実装します
- Document Information - ドキュメントのメタデータと構造にアクセスします
- Advanced Features - 専門的な注釈機能と最適化
- Configuration Options - 注釈の動作とパフォーマンスをカスタマイズします
今すぐ試す方法
包括的なチュートリアルとサンプルコードを確認し、アプリケーションに強力な注釈機能を実装してください。共同ドキュメントレビューシステム、教育ツール、コンテンツ管理ソリューションのいずれを構築する場合でも、document annotation API が必要な機能を提供します。
無料トライアル
購入前にすべての機能を試せる無料トライアルで始めましょう。
Download Trial
API ドキュメント
サポートされているすべてのプラットフォーム向けの詳細な API リファレンスです。
Browse API Reference
よくある質問
Q: document annotation API を商用製品で使用できますか?
A: はい。製品環境での展開には有効な GroupDocs ライセンスが必要で、評価用に無料トライアルが利用可能です。
Q: API はパスワード保護された PDF をサポートしていますか?
A: もちろんです。ドキュメントを開く際にパスワードを指定でき、すべての注釈操作は透過的に機能します。
Q: 対応している .NET バージョンはどれですか?
A: SDK は .NET Framework 4.5 以上、.NET Core 3.1 以上、.NET 5、.NET 6 以上をサポートしています。
Q: API は大きなファイルをどのように処理しますか?
A: コンテンツをストリーミングし、Document.OptimizeResources() のようなメモリ最適化メソッドを提供してメモリ使用量を抑えます。
Q: クラウドストレージサービスの組み込みサポートはありますか?
A: はい。Amazon S3、Azure Blob Storage、Google Cloud Storage などのクラウドプロバイダーから直接ドキュメントをロード・保存できます。
最終更新日: 2026-02-16
テスト環境: GroupDocs.Annotation 23.11 for .NET & Java
作者: GroupDocs